If Salesian was riding high fresh off their 66-33 takedown of Tuckahoe last Thursday, their most recent game may have dampened their spirits a bit. The Salesian Eagles took a 38-34 hit to the loss column at the hands of the Monsignor McClancy Crusaders. The game marked the Eagles' lowest-scoring contest so far this season.

When it comes to explaining why Salesian lost on Friday, don't look at Julien Wiggins. Despite the final result, he went 10 of 18 on his way to 24 points in addition to five boards and three steals. Wiggins' evening made it six games in a row in which he has scored at least ten points. The team also got some help courtesy of Jonathan Lagos, who posted eight points.

Salesian's loss dropped their record down to 3-3. As for Monsignor McClancy, their victory (their first of the season) made their record 1-2.

Both teams will have to hit the road in their upcoming games. Salesian will venture away from home to challenge Moore Catholic at 4:30 p.m. on Sunday. Monsignor McClancy and Monsignor Farrell will compete for holiday cheer at 1:00 p.m. on Sunday.
